Book Synopsis Dog Days by : John Levitt

Download or read book Dog Days written by John Levitt and published by Penguin. This book was released on 2007-10-30 with total page 308 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: First in a new urban fantasy series-with a bite as magical as its bark. Mason used to be an enforcer, ensuring that suspect magic practitioners stayed in line. But now he scrapes out a living playing guitar. Good thing he has Louie, his magical...well, let's call him a dog. But there are some kinds of evil that even Louie can't sniff out. And when Mason is attacked by a supernatural assailant, he'll have to fall back on the one skill he's mastered in music and magic-improvisation.
